As weather patterns continue to shift and evolve, various parts of the United States are currently under different weather warnings, ranging from floods to frost and high winds. These warnings, issued by the National Weather Service (NWS), highlight the diverse and sometimes extreme conditions affecting different regions.
In Colorado and Utah, a Flood Watch has been issued due to excessive rainfall, with total amounts of 1-2 inches expected and locally higher amounts up to 3 inches possible. The impacted areas include the Animas River Basin, Four Corners, and other regions. The heavy rain, fueled by tropical moisture, poses a risk of flash flooding, potentially affecting urban areas, dry washes, and recent burn scars. Rockslides and mudslides are also possible in mountainous areas.
On the East Coast, a Coastal Flood Statement has been issued for Southern Fairfield County in New York, with up to one half foot of inundation above ground level expected. This statement is in effect until Friday afternoon, with the possibility of moderate or greater coastal flooding from a coastal storm starting on Sunday. Additionally, a Frost Advisory and Freeze Warning have been issued for various counties in West Virginia and North Dakota, with temperatures dropping to the lower 30s and potentially harming sensitive outdoor vegetation.
In Alaska, a High Wind Watch has been issued for several areas, including the Bering Strait Coast and Interior Seward Peninsula, with south winds of 30 to 50 mph and gusts up to 70 mph possible. These high winds could lead to property damage, power outages, and travel disruptions, especially for high-profile vehicles.
